The business landscape for professional services is rapidly changing. Traditional models centered around billable hours have faced increasing scrutiny for their scalability limitations and inconsistent revenue streams. Firms, especially in law, compliance, and HR, are beginning to explore subscription-based offerings supported by artificial intelligence (AI). Leveraging insights from McKinsey’s 'Superagency in the Workplace,' this article highlights how AI can facilitate this transformation, providing a pathway towards continuous, data-driven services that generate stable, recurring revenue.
Historically, clients in professional services have been accustomed to the billable hour model, which, while straightforward, limits scalability and often leads to fluctuating revenue. The pace of business demands that professional services deliver solutions at a rapid rate. AI empowers firms to automate repetitive tasks, thus enabling quicker turnaround times. This real-time service provision supports subscription models by ensuring that clients receive consistent and timely value. For example, legal firms using AI for contract reviews can provide clients with swift feedback, thereby enhancing client satisfaction and retention rates.
